AWC strengthens the community by providing substantial scholarship money to women in higher education or apprenticeships who are seeking construction industry-related degrees and experience, which helps increase the overall number of women in the industry.

The AWC has successfully awarded over $30,000 in scholarships to young women attending college, technical or trade school in construction-related fields, such as skilled trades, engineering, architecture and construction management. Our annual golf outing is the primary event that raises money for scholarships. The AWC also provides mentoring relationships and opportunities for employment. Scholarship recipients are encouraged to volunteer at our events to network with female CEO's, presidents and women business owners.

In 2007, we awarded seven $1,000 scholarships to the following women:

  • Alicia Mankowski, from Brainerd, electricial at MN State Community and Technical College-Wadena
  • Josina Manu, from Minneapolis, cabinet making at Minneapolis Community and Technology College
  • Kerry McNeill, from Roseville, cabinet making at Saint Paul College
  • Laura Dykema, from Minneapolis, construction management at North Hennepin Community College
  • Margaret Billings, from Duluth, civil engineering technology at Lake Superior College
  • Sarah Burg, from Richmond, HVAC at Saint Cloud Technical College
  • Tina Miller, from Leonard, construction management at Minnesota State University Moorhead

Qualifications for the scholarship are:

1. Female Student
2. Current resident of Minnesota OR attending a college or trade institution in Minnesota
3. High School graduate or GED
4. Construction Industry Major
